Dynamic Rewards That Transform Routine Gameplay Into Discovery
Modern video games are continually finding innovative ways to maintain player interest over extended gaming sessions. One of the most effective strategies is replacing static reward structures with adaptive systems that react directly to user choices. By shifting the focus from predictable grinding to meaningful exploration, game developers can turn standard repetitive tasks into captivating moments of genuine discovery.
Reframing Repetitive Mechanics Through Adaptive Systems
In traditional game design, players often knew precisely what item or score bonus would result from completing a specific quest. While this provided clarity, it frequently led to fatigue as sessions began to feel more like chores than entertainment. Dynamic reward engines solve this issue by introducing controlled variability that keeps each interaction feeling novel.
When outcomes adapt to how a player navigates a virtual world, simple actions gain new depth. Players start paying closer attention to subtle environmental cues and hidden mechanics rather than rushing toward a fixed goal post. This subtle shift transforms standard movement and interaction into an active process of curiosity and learning.
The Role of Exploration in Player Engagement
Curiosity serves as a powerful psychological motivator in interactive digital environments. When games encourage players to venture off the main path by offering unexpected incentives, the overall experience becomes significantly richer. This sense of personal agency makes every discovered secret feel earned rather than scripted.
Designing an effective discovery loop requires careful calibration to avoid overwhelming the player. Developers must balance rare, high-value bonuses with consistent small victories so that exploration always feels worthwhile. Maintaining steady progress helps sustain long-term enthusiasm without causing burnout.

Balancing Unpredictability with Fair Progression
While dynamic systems thrive on unexpected outcomes, excessive randomness can cause frustration if players feel their efforts are unrewarded. To prevent this, modern systems utilize hidden progression counters that guarantee payouts after a designated number of attempts. This hybrid approach preserves the excitement of surprise while maintaining a fair foundation.
When players trust that the game respects their spent time, they are much more willing to experiment with different strategies. A well-designed balance between chance and guaranteed milestones ensures that every play style finds a rewarding path forward.

Bridge Games For Players Who Enjoy Mental Challenges
Contract bridge is widely celebrated as one of the most intellectually stimulating tabletop card games ever devised. It offers an intricate combination of mathematical probability, tactical foresight, and psychological deduction that appeals directly to competitive thinkers. Players who thrive on complex problem-solving find immense satisfaction in deciphering the subtle layers of strategy required for every hand.
The Dynamic Nature of Analytical Bidding
The bidding phase in bridge acts as a sophisticated information exchange where players construct a mental model of the hidden cards. Every call communicates precise details regarding suit length and high-card strength to both a partner and observant opponents. Mastering this structured language demands sharp concentration and an ability to calculate changing probabilities on the fly.
As the auction unfolds, analytical minds must continuously re-evaluate their expectations and adapt to unexpected bids. Strategic flexibility is critical when navigating competitive auctions where space is limited and risks must be carefully balanced. Deductive Reasoning in Trick-Taking Play
Once the bidding concludes, the focus shifts entirely to the tactical play of the cards where deep calculation comes into full focus. Declarers must plan their line of play several moves in advance while considering potential suit distributions and defensive threats. This forward-thinking process mirrors the strategic depth found in high-level chess matches.
Defenders face an equally rigorous cognitive workout as they work together to disrupt the declarer's plan using subtle signals. Deductive reasoning allows players to track missing high cards and reconstruct hidden hands purely through observation. Success relies on logical deduction, precise memory retention, and unflinching attention to detail throughout the entire deal.
Partnership Coordination Under Limited Information
Beyond individual calculation, bridge presents the unique challenge of coordinating seamlessly with a partner without explicit verbal communication. Partners must rely entirely on standardized bidding rules and defensive card signals to align their strategies. Building this level of unspoken trust creates a fascinating psychological dynamic that keeps players deeply engaged.
Navigating errors or unexpected plays from a partner tests emotional control and adaptability under competitive pressure. Highly successful partnerships view every hand as a collaborative puzzle requiring mutual calibration and quick adjustment. This shared intellectual pursuit makes the game uniquely rewarding for social thinkers who enjoy intense team dynamics.
